Web24 nov. 2014 · To remove any fusing agent that remains on the fabric, cover it with a damp, lightweight fabric scrap and press. Peel off while warm. Continue with new … Web8 okt. 2009 · If you carefully iron the spot again it should be removeable. Put the quilt with the spot up on the ironing board. Cover it with a clean cotton cloth and iron until the glue is warm. While it's still warm (or hot!) rub the glue off. This technique has worked for me when the glue is fresh and the fabric still has its factory finish on it. Best ...
